A stock just paid a dividend of $1.19 - that is to say D0 = $1.19. The required rate of return is rs = 15.14%, and the constant annual growth rate in dividends is 5.87%.

Answers

Therefore, the price of the stock based on the dividend discount model is $16.77.

Using the dividend discount model, we can find the price of the stock based on the information given:

P0 = D1 / (rs - g)

Where:

D0 = $1.19 (the dividend just paid)

g = 5.87% (the constant annual growth rate in dividends)

rs = 15.14% (the required rate of return)

First, we need to find D1, the dividend expected one year from now:

D1 = D0 * (1 + g) = $1.19 * (1 + 0.0587) = $1.26

Now we can use the formula to find P0:

P0 = $1.26 / (0.1514 - 0.0587) = $16.77

The scores on one portion of a standardized test are approximately Normally distributed, N(572, 51). a. Use the 68-95-99.7 rule to estimate the range of scores that includes the middle 95% of these test scores. b. Use technology to estimate the range of scores that includes the middle 90% of these test scores.

Answers

Answer:

a) The range of scores that includes the middle 95% of these test scores is between 470 and 674.

b) The range of scores that includes the middle 90% of these test scores is between 488.1 and 655.9.

Step-by-step explanation:

68-95-99.7 rule:

The Empirical Rule states that, for a normally distributed random variable:

68% of the measures are within 1 standard deviation of the mean.

95% of the measures are within 2 standard deviation of the mean.

99.7% of the measures are within 3 standard deviations of the mean.

In this problem, we have that:

Z-score:

Problems of normally distributed samples are solved using the z-score formula.

In a set with mean \(\mu\) and standard deviation \(\sigma\), the zscore of a measure X is given by:

\(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}\)

The Z-score measures how many standard deviations the measure is from the mean. After finding the Z-score, we look at the z-score table and find the p-value associated with this z-score. This p-value is the probability that the value of the measure is smaller than X, that is, the percentile of X. Subtracting 1 by the pvalue, we get the probability that the value of the measure is greater than X.

In this question:

Mean \(\mu = 572\), standard deviation \(\sigma = 51\)

a. Use the 68-95-99.7 rule to estimate the range of scores that includes the middle 95% of these test scores.

By the 68-95-99.7 rule, within 2 standard deviations of the mean.

572 - 2*51 = 470

572 + 2*51 = 674

The range of scores that includes the middle 95% of these test scores is between 470 and 674.

b. Use technology to estimate the range of scores that includes the middle 90% of these test scores.

Using the z-score formula.

Between these following percentiles:

50 - (90/2) = 5th percentile

50 + (90/2) = 95th percentile.

5th percentile.

X when Z has a pvalue of 0.05. So when X when Z = -1.645.

\(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}\)

\(-1.645 = \frac{X - 572}{51}\)

\(X - 572 = -1.645*51\)

\(X = 488.1\)

95th percentile.

X when Z has a pvalue of 0.95. So when X when Z = 1.645.

\(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}\)

\(1.645 = \frac{X - 572}{51}\)

\(X - 572 = 1.645*51\)

\(X = 655.9\)

The range of scores that includes the middle 90% of these test scores is between 488.1 and 655.9.
